IDGC of Centre - Kostromaenergo division continues implementing measures to provide remote control of power grid facilities using a system of high-speed data channels based on fiber-optic communication lines (FOCL). At the beginning of 2016 in the service area of Kostromaenergo 1,663 kilometres of fiber-optic networks were constructed. Today, through the fiber optic channels Kostromaenergo's head office is linked with 25 of 27 Distribution Zones and about half of 35-110 kV substations (SS).

During 2016 Kostromaenergo's experts plan to install fiber at eight power centres in Kostroma, Kostromsky and Susaninsky districts of the region (SS 110 kV 'Airport' and 'Vasilyevo', SS 35 kV 'Karavaevo', 'Kuznetsovo', 'Korkino', 'Ilyinskaya', 'Sukhonogovo' and 'Kalininskaya'). In Buisky district an optic line will connect the SS 220 kV 'Borok' in the settlement of Chistye Bory and three 110 kV substations in the town of Bui. Installation and commissioning work of the equipment will begin in late July.

Work on laying the fiber-optic communication lines is carried out with the involvement of investors, communication operators, who use Kostromaenergo's infrastructure for fiber suspension. In exchange of permission to use the poles investors transfer some optical fibers in a cable to Kostroma power engineers of IDGC of Centre in an amount sufficient to meet the needs of the company for the long term.

Installation of remote control for power grid infrastructure via fiber optic lines allows Kostromaenergo's specialists to save time and costs of operational maintenance, remotely control and monitor power consumption settings and operations necessary with power equipment, monitor the status of power supply circuits and ranges of equipment work. This provides a significant increase in efficiency of prevention, response and liquidation of emergency situations, and as a result, contributes to the reliability and quality of electricity supply to consumers.
